Package io.guise.framework.event
Interface ProgressListenable<P>
-
- Type Parameters:
P
- The type of progress being made.
- All Known Subinterfaces:
PlatformFile
- All Known Implementing Classes:
AbstractPlatformFile
,Audio
,PlatformFileUploadPanel
,WebPlatformFile
public interface ProgressListenable<P>
An object that allows the registration of progress listeners.- Author:
- Garret Wilson
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description void
addProgressListener(ProgressListener<P> progressListener)
Adds a progress listener.void
removeProgressListener(ProgressListener<P> progressListener)
Removes an progress listener.
-
-
-
Method Detail
-
addProgressListener
void addProgressListener(ProgressListener<P> progressListener)
Adds a progress listener.- Parameters:
progressListener
- The progress listener to add.
-
removeProgressListener
void removeProgressListener(ProgressListener<P> progressListener)
Removes an progress listener.- Parameters:
progressListener
- The progress listener to remove.
-
-